As a Louisiana homebuyer, you also have access to state-specific programs that can make financing more affordable. The Louisiana Housing Corporation (LHC) offers several mortgage programs, including the Market Rate GNMA Program and the MCC (Mortgage Credit Certificate) program, which can provide competitive interest rates and valuable federal tax credits for first-time and repeat buyers. A knowledgeable local lender will be well-versed in these programs and can guide you on whether you qualify, helping you stretch your buying power further in Gueydan's market.
Your actionable advice starts with these three steps. First, get pre-approved, not just pre-qualified. In our smaller market, sellers take offers more seriously when they see solid proof of financing. Second, ask every lender you interview specific questions: "Do you regularly lend in Vermilion Parish?" "Can you explain the Louisiana LHC programs?" "How do you handle appraisals for older or unique properties common in Gueydan?" Their answers will tell you a lot. Finally, don't overlook the power of a local real estate agent's recommendation. Agents see which lenders close smoothly and on time, and they can often point you to the most reliable partners.
